Olson, David Olin – 1969
The purpose of this study was to determine whether educable mentally retarded pupils could perform certain woodworking skills with a measurable degree of proficiency following instruction and training in the use of eight selected hand tools. Pupils were aged 11 to 15 years with I.Q.'s ranging from 47 to 83. Two groups were formed according to low…

Bruwelheide, Kenneth L. – 1979
A study was conducted to identify and develop instructional aids in the form of physical apparatus that would permit students with physical handicaps and/or limitations to have greater access to laboratory-shop courses in Montana secondary schools. Steps taken in carrying out the study included the following: (1) identifying the physically…
